The Fundamentals of Quantum Computing

What is Quantum Computing?

Quantum computing is a new type of machine that uses tiny particles called qubits. Unlike regular bits that are either 0 or 1, qubits can be both at once thanks to a property called superposition. This allows quantum computers to process many possibilities simultaneously. Another key idea is entanglement—the ability of qubits to connect instantly over long distances. This makes quantum computers potentially much faster and more powerful than current ones. Today, countries and large companies are racing to develop hardware capable of quantum breakthroughs, though it’s still in early stages.

How Quantum Computers Differ from Classical Computers

Classical computers use bits to perform calculations step by step, which is fast enough for most tasks. But they hit limits when tackling complex problems. Quantum computers can do some of these tasks much faster due to superposition and entanglement. For example, they could crack codes or optimize big systems much more efficiently. Still, quantum tech faces hurdles: managing error rates, keeping qubits stable, and building large-scale machines. These issues slow down how soon we’ll see widespread use.

Timeline for Quantum Computing Maturity

Industry experts predict big changes are coming. Companies like IBM, Google, and startups are making key strides. Google claims to have achieved “quantum supremacy,” solving problems that supercomputers struggle with. But full-blown, practical quantum computers that can handle real-world tasks might take years—possibly a decade or more. Still, predictions vary, and some think we are closer than expected. Watching these milestones is key for preparing our digital world.

Impact of Quantum Computing on Cryptography

Vulnerabilities of Current Cryptographic Algorithms

Cryptography keeps our online info safe using math codes. RSA and ECC are the most common standards for encrypting data—used in everything from banking to messaging. These systems rely on the difficulty of factoring large numbers or solving complex math. But quantum algorithms, like Shor’s algorithm, could break these codes quickly. That means data once considered secure could become easily accessible. For example, encrypted emails or transactions could be exposed if an attacker has access to a powerful quantum computer.

The Transition to Post-Quantum Cryptography

In response, researchers are developing new cryptographic methods that quantum computers can’t crack easily. These are called post-quantum algorithms. They include lattice-based, hash-based, and code-based cryptography. The National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) is actively working on standardizing these new algorithms. Companies and organizations need to prepare now by adopting cryptography that can resist future quantum threats. This way, they won’t be caught unprotected when quantum computers become mainstream.

Risks to Blockchain and Cryptocurrency Security

Blockchain technology depends on cryptography to secure transactions and wallets. Quantum computers could break this protection, risking the entire system. Private keys stored in wallets might become vulnerable, allowing hackers to steal digital assets. Major c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um rely on cryptographic algorithms that are vulnerable. If quantum computers become capable, they could enable double-spending or drain funds, leading to huge security breaches and loss of trust in digital currencies.

Preparing the Cryptocurrency Ecosystem for Quantum Threats

Developing Quantum-Resistant Blockchain Protocols

To protect cryptocurrencies, developers are exploring ways to incorporate quantum-safe cryptography. This involves designing new protocols that can withstand quantum attacks. Some projects test these algorithms directly on blockchain networks. By integrating quantum-resistant algorithms, they aim to keep transactions secure no matter how advanced computers become. Several startups are already working on these innovations, aiming to future-proof crypto networks.

Policy and Regulation Considerations

Governments and regulators play a big role in guiding safe digital currency use. International standards for quantum-safe encryption are being discussed to create a unified defense against future threats. Policymakers should encourage quick adoption of quantum-resistant tech and make rules for digital asset security. This helps protect investors and maintains confidence in the ongoing development of blockchain systems.
